Katherine Nelson-Coffey, Ph.D

Lab Director

​Katherine Nelson-Coffey is an Associate Professor of Psychology in the School of Social and Behavioral Sciences at Arizona State University. She earned her bachelor's of science in Psychology from the University of Mary Washington in 2008 and her Ph.D. in 2015 from the University of California, Riverside, where she studied personality and social psychology with Sonja Lyubomirsky. She is passionate about using psychological science to improve the lives of parents and families. She also loves spending time with her family, reading, running, hiking and spending time outdoors, and traveling.
